# Getting Started

## **Quickstart**

Bluwhale integration currently focuses on accessing structured user intelligence through the Bluwhale Profile and data layers.

Developers interact with Bluwhale by connecting identity (e.g. wallet) and querying user-related data.

***

### **Prerequisites**

Basic understanding of Web3 identity (wallets) and API-based systems is recommended.
